| Objective: To study the factor affecting the recurrence of giant cell tumor of bone.Methods: Data was come from these patients in our hospital between 2002 and 2006, and the data was analyzed by Logistic regression analysis and Chi-Square test to analyze 10 factors, such as age, sex, location of tumor, period of symptoms, operative mode, alkaline phosphates' level, pathological grading and image grading. Results: the period of symptoms, operative mode, bone cement, pathological grading and alkaline phosphates' level is related factors of the recurrence of bone giant cell tumor. The recurrence of the group with bone cement is 9.62 %, it's lower than the group without it ( P<0.05 ). And the group with deactivation during operation has lower recurrence (11.59%) than the group with it (27.45%) (P<0.05). Conclusion: operative mode and pathological grading are important factors for predicting behavior of bone giant cell tumor. The recurrence of intra capsular curettage is obviously higher than local or wide excision. The period of symtoms and alkaline phosphates' level are useful hints for the risk of recurrence. So intra capsular curettage should be avoid to these patients who have high pathological gradingand long period symptoms or high level of alkaline phosphate. But bone cement can decrease the recurrence to these patients who have low risk of it by intra capsular curettage. |
